And now, they’re presenting their Agile for Humanity 2022 Conference that will develop over February 22th to 26th of 2022. The Agile for Humanity conference is an experience of Belonging for everyone to participate in sharing and learning together, there will be a special emphasis on the Black, Indigenous, and People of Color (BIPOC) community to have an equal voice. The intent is to create a focused space for BOPIC to Elevate its Craft and Mastery in product development, agility, design, and technology. They invite their non-BIPOC mutual partners to come along on this journey with them.

Their program is divided into days in where you’ll find on:

  • Tuesday, February 22 – Wednesday, February 23, 2022: Learning and Development Certifications.
  • Thursday, February 24 – Learning and Development Workshops such as Conscious Leadership by Ann-Marie Kong, 3 Essential Skills for Better Coaching Conversations by Salah Elleithy, High-Performing Teams by Richard Kasperowski, and Empathy Dojo 2.0 by Lorraine Aguilar.
  • Friday, February 25 – Conference Day 1 sharing a BIPOC Stories Panel by Dave Cornelius.
  • February 26 – Conference Day 2 with an Agile Educator Panel monitored by Charles Collingwood.

Among this year’s organizers, you’ll find Dr. Dave Cornelius aka “Dr. Dave”: professional coach, trainer, Agile leader, and evangelist. Joseph Jones: servant leader and agile change agent, LPC, AnaElsa: Future Search Facilitator and Ashanti as Graphic Recorder.
